Why Live in Hunterwood

Hunterwood, a small neighborhood 12 miles from downtown Houston, is a suburban community known for its proximity to energy production facilities like NRG Energy's Greens Bayou Generating Station. This makes it a convenient location for industrial workers, with major plants such as ExxonMobil and Shell situated further east. The neighborhood's affordability and central location are appealing to homebuyers. Although Hunterwood lacks walkability and public transportation, it benefits from access to major roads, including Route 90 and Beltway 8, allowing a 20-minute drive to downtown Houston via Interstate 10, though traffic can be heavy. Grocery shopping options include Joe V's Smart Shop and Food Town on Wallisville Road, while The Shops at Stone Park offers big-box retailers. Dining features a mix of national chains and local favorites like El Trompo Loco and Bibo's Cafe. While Hunterwood does not have community parks, Gene Green Park, 4 miles east, offers a splash pad, skatepark, and dog park, and Jim and Joann Fonteno Family Park provides a looped path through 33 acres of wooded terrain. Housing in Hunterwood includes ranch-style homes from the 1980s in Hunterwood Village and larger New Traditional-style homes in Pine Tree, with apartments and townhouses available at Lake Houston Pines. Students attend schools in the Galena Park Independent School District, with North Shore Senior High School noted for its high rating and competitive athletics program.

Is Hunterwood a good place to live?
Hunterwood is a good place to live, receiving 3.1 stars from its residents. Hunterwood is considered very car-dependent and somewhat bikeable with minimal transit options. Hunterwood is a suburban neighborhood. Hunterwood has 7 parks for recreational activities. It is fairly sparse in population with 3.5 people per acre and a median age of 32. The average household income is $68,380 which is below the national average. College graduates make up 6.9% of residents. A majority of residents in Hunterwood are home owners, with 39.6% of residents renting and 60.4% of residents owning their home.
